How Alameda County Mugshots Revealed - Everyday Crimes in the Bay Area Actually Works
To understand Alameda County Mugshots Revealed - Everyday Crimes in the Bay Area, it helps to know where the information comes from and what it represents. When someone is arrested by a local police agency in Alameda County, booking procedures typically include taking a photograph, recording personal details, and noting the alleged offense. That information may later be entered into a public records system that allows interested parties to search by name or other identifiers. Because these records are generally open in California, members of the public can access basic data about arrests that have been processed through the system.
It is important to see this system as a snapshot rather than a final judgment. For example, an entry for Alameda County Mugshots Revealed - Everyday Crimes in the Bay Area might list an arrest for a theft-related incident, but it does not indicate whether the person was charged, convicted, or even found innocent. Many cases are resolved with diversion programs, dropped charges, or plea agreements that never result in a conviction. Others may reflect misunderstandings or situations that are resolved quickly within the justice system. By treating these records as starting points for further inquiry, readers can avoid drawing conclusions based on limited details and instead use the information to ask better questions about patterns and root causes.

Things People Often Misunderstand
A frequent misunderstanding is that every entry in Alameda County Mugshots Revealed - Everyday Crimes in the Bay Area leads directly to a conviction or that it reflects an ongoing threat. In reality, many arrests do not result in charges, and some are resolved through diversion or other non-punitive pathways. Another misconception is that the person pictured is always guilty, when in fact the American legal system operates on the principle of innocence until proven guilty. These misunderstandings can skew public conversation and erode trust in both the justice system and the data itself.
It is also sometimes assumed that access to these records is a new phenomenon, but California has long required many public agencies to release basic information about arrests and bookings. What has changed is the ease and speed with which individuals can locate and review this information online.
